Mô Tả Công Việc
- Thiết kế và triển khai kiến trúc Web và Mobile tổng thể
- Thiết kế và xây dựng cơ sở dữ liệu, API
- Tích hợp giao diện người dùng và API
- Đảm bảo toàn bộ hệ thống được thiết kế và xây dựng chạy nhanh và có khả năng mở rộng
- Thiết kế và thực hiện việc tích hợp và triển khai liên tục (CI/CD)
Yêu Cầu Công Việc
- Tốt nghiệp Đại học trở lên về lĩnh vực Công nghệ thông tin, kỹ thuật, hoặc các liên quan
- Có kinh nghiệm làm việc ở vị trí Backend Java lĩnh vực ngân hàng, tài chính
- Có kinh nghiệm tối thiểu 3 năm hoặc chuyên sâu các công nghệ bên dưới:
- Frontend Web: HTML, HTML5, Javascript ES6, JQuery, CSS, Angular/AngularJS.
- Frontend Mobile: Native Android (Java, Kotlin), Native iOS (Swift / Objective-C), React Native / Flutter.
- Backend: Java, Spring Boot, Gradle, RDS, Rest API
- Database: SQL, NoSQL
- Testing: Postman, Unit test
- Kỹ năng CSS tốt, có kinh nghiệm về Sass, Less,…là một lợi thế
- Có kinh nghiệm xây dựng ứng dụng đa nền tảng
- Nắm vững cách sử dụng source control GitHub/GitLab
- Nắm vững các giao tiếp micro services
- Có kinh nghiệm vững về OOP, Design Pattern
- Có kinh nghiệm về Caching: MemCache, Redis Cache,..
- Có kinh nghiệm làm việc với các thuật toán mã hoá: EAS / DES, RSA,…
- Nắm vững về kiến trúc hệ thống, có kinh nghiệm tích hợp với các hệ thống liên quan
- Có kinh nghiệm về Scrum, Agile
- Có kinh nghiệm làm việc với Docker, Jenkins, AWS, Kubernetes, …
- Có kinh nghiệm về quy trình phát triển phần mềm và quản lý dự án triển khai phần mềm.
- Có kỹ năng đọc hiểu và viết tài liệu Tiếng Anh, Tiếng Việt
- Phân tích tốt yêu cầu nghiệp vụ, kỹ thuật, thiết kế
- Kỹ năng giải quyết vấn đề tốt
- Kỹ năng làm việc nhóm tốt
- Kiến trúc thuật toán và tối ưu, tái cấu trúc mã nguồn tốt
Hình thức
Full-Time
Mức lương
Thỏa thuận
Báo cáo tin tuyển dụng: Nếu bạn thấy rằng tin tuyển dụng này không đúng hoặc có dấu hiệu lừa đảo,
hãy phản ánh với chúng tôi.